LINUX.ORG.RU
 
svyatogor

Fork проекта XMMS - Beep.


0

0

Beep - это медиа плейер основанный на XMMS. Основной целью отделения является улуьшение пользовательского интерфейса с использованием последних технологий (GTK2, Pango) и юзабилити, при поддержке настраемого скинами интерфейса.

>>> Подробности

ЗАСТАВЬ КОМПЬЮТЕР ПОЛИВАТЬ ОГОРОД

автоматизация своими руками: электроприборы под контролем компьютера
beware of programmers who carry screwdrivers!
http://www.unicontrollers.com/products/unc01x

[#]  

Re: Fork проекта XMMS - Beep.

Оно понятно и хорошо. Вот только смогут ребята сохранить основной API для плагинов? Если нет, то это совсем не гуд.

*** ()
[#]  

Re: Fork проекта XMMS - Beep.

Давно пора, непонятно почему в основной ветке этого еще не сделали. GTK+ на помойку :)

anonymous ()
[#]  

Re: Fork проекта XMMS - Beep.

Еще один винамп. Неужели никто так и не додумается сделать плейер с нормальным интерфейсом?

anonymous ()
[#] Ответ на: Re: Fork проекта XMMS - Beep. от anonymous 23.10.2003 17:17:27  

Re: Re: Fork проекта XMMS - Beep.

>Еще один винамп. Неужели никто так и не додумается сделать плейер с нормальным интерфейсом?
mpg123 ? :)

А если серьезно, что подразумевается под "плейером с нормальным интерфейсом" ? Qt?

** ()
[#] Ответ на: Re: Re: Fork проекта XMMS - Beep. от ANDI 23.10.2003 17:22:55  

Re: Re: Re: Fork проекта XMMS - Beep.

Нормальный интерфейс - это интерфейс, отличный от размалеванного винамповского квадратика. Вообще не понимаю, зачем было тянуть эту гадость в линукс.

anonymous ()
[#]  

Re: Fork проекта XMMS - Beep.

Ура! Теперь у нас еще больше патчей для автоперекодировки будет! Ура!

anonymous ()
[#] Ответ на: Re: Fork проекта XMMS - Beep. от Korwin 23.10.2003 17:00:10  
Banshee

Re: Re: Fork проекта XMMS - Beep.

Согласен. Если бы не xmms, выбросил бы gtk1 нафиг.

* ()
[#] Ответ на: Re: Fork проекта XMMS - Beep. от anonymous 23.10.2003 17:17:27  

Re: Re: Fork проекта XMMS - Beep.

Посмотри на alsaplayer там нет привязки к конкретному тулкиту,
интерфейсы как плагины подключаются. Только там есть проблемы с
перекодировкой тегов ogg, нет даже намека на перекодировку...

anonymous ()
[#]  

Re: Fork проекта XMMS - Beep.

Не понял. Зачем вам все эти WinAmp`ообразие?
Какой еще нужен интерфейс к плееру, акромя того, что есть у mpg123 & aumix?

Я лично использую исключительно данную связку и вполне себе доволен - что я теряю? И зачем усложнять себе жизнь?

* ()
[#] Ответ на: Re: Re: Fork проекта XMMS - Beep. от anonymous 23.10.2003 17:48:01  
Evgueni

Re: anonymous (*) (23.10.2003 17:48:01)

Что-то не понял, а зачем теги в ogg перекодировать? Там же unicode по стандарту?

***** ()
[#]  

Re: Fork проекта XMMS - Beep.

Пипил, научите xmms файло по вебу перематывать...
Ну кошмарно просто, одни мучения йопт :(

Так не хочу винамп в вайне пускать :((

* ()
[#]  

Учите русский язык!

Для тех, кто не учился в школе: "player" = "проигрыватель".

anonymous ()
[#] Ответ на: Учите русский язык! от anonymous 23.10.2003 18:12:12  

Re: Учите русский язык!

> Для тех, кто не учился в школе: "player" = "проигрыватель".

Дак и шо? Надо ставить ответ не на тему, а на мессагу.
Ты про Qt-то? Так там было указано про "интерфейс", а не плеер.

Qt/GTK ессно маздай. И лучшего интерфейса, чем у mpg123 придумать сложно. Я вот пока затрудняюсь. Хотя и написал для mpg123 довольно продвинутый враппер...

* ()
[#]  

Re: Fork проекта XMMS - Beep.

вот черт... придется теперь патч для перекодировки названий тоже форкать

anonymous ()
[#] Ответ на: Re: Учите русский язык! от philon 23.10.2003 18:30:36  

Re: Re: Учите русский язык!

>И лучшего интерфейса, чем у mpg123 придумать сложно.
Интерфейс-то хороший... вот только кроме mp3 ничего больше не понимает... а mp3 - сакс;)
А вобще неплохо было бы иметь эдакий soundd с плагинами, который бы загружался при старте как сервис и управлялся бы по HTTP (как это
делает CUPS), тогда и интерфейс к нему можно было бы прикрутить любой
в два счёта: хоть CLI, хоть GUI, хоть Web...

***## ()
[#] Ответ на: Учите русский язык! от anonymous 23.10.2003 18:12:12  
svyatogor

Re: Учите русский язык!

>Для тех, кто не учился в школе: "player" = "проигрыватель" Hey man, I can speak english at least not worse than you do. Ok? А плейер - термин тперь интернациональный.

***** ()
[#] Ответ на: Re: Re: Учите русский язык! от Led 23.10.2003 19:04:07  

Re: Fork проекта XMMS - Beep.

> вот только кроме mp3 ничего больше не понимает... а mp3 - сакс;)

Верно. Для ogg - ogg123 уже ;-(

Но и этому горю можно помочь ;-)
================================
Package: music123 9
A command-line shell for sound-file players

A command-line shell for programs like mpg123 and ogg123, music123 plays a variety of sound files using a mpg123/ogg123-like interface. With all the Recommends installed, music123 plays wav, mp3 and ogg files. By simply changing the config file, music123 can play any sound file you have a player for.
================================

* ()
[#] Ответ на: Re: Re: Fork проекта XMMS - Beep. от anonymous 23.10.2003 17:48:01  
Dselect

про перекодировку tag'-ов в ogg...

2 anonymous (*) (23.10.2003 17:48:01):

> Только там есть проблемы с перекодировкой тегов ogg, нет даже намека на перекодировку...

Позвольте осведомиться, а на# она там нужна? AFAIK, в ogg tag'-и в UNICODE...

P.S.

Восьмибитные кодировки -- на помойку!

*** ()
[#] Ответ на: Re: Учите русский язык! от philon 23.10.2003 18:30:36  
Dselect

про междумордие к проигрывателю...

2 philon:

>И лучшего интерфейса, чем у mpg123 придумать сложно.

xmms-shell. Еще бы нашлась добрая душа и выкинула из xmms весь xlib/gtk staff -- вообще было бы здорово...

*** ()
[#] Ответ на: Re: Re: Re: Fork проекта XMMS - Beep. от anonymous 23.10.2003 17:33:01  
Fice

Re: Re: Re: Re: Fork проекта XMMS - Beep.

Кстати, лучший графический интерфейс (ничево против CLI не имею - тоже нужно) у gqmpeg (IMHO) - радует возможность визуального редактирования скинов :)

** ()
[#] Ответ на: Re: Учите русский язык! от svyatogor 23.10.2003 19:05:24  

Re: Re: Учите русский язык!

>Hey man, I can speak english at least not worse than you do. Ok?
I would rather not be that assured if i were you and i'm pretty sure you have not passed an ordinary level ;)

>А плейер - термин тперь интернациональный.
В русском языке есть слово, которое абсолютно адекватно отражает смысл "player". Тот факт, что у кого-то проблемы с базовой лексикой, не добавляет в русский язык мусор вроде "плейер", "роутер", "вау".

anonymous ()
[#] Ответ на: про междумордие к проигрывателю... от Dselect 23.10.2003 19:30:03  

Re: Fork проекта XMMS - Beep.

> xmms-shell

Правильной дорогой XMMS шел, возможно...

> Еще бы нашлась добрая душа и выкинула из xmms весь xlib/gtk staff

А нафига ж? Это ж сколько лишних сучностей?

music123 (+mpg123 +ogg123) не есть избыточен. А вот связка XMMS+xmms-shell избыточна явно.

* ()
[#] Ответ на: Re: Fork проекта XMMS - Beep. от philon 23.10.2003 19:39:57  

Re: Re: Fork проекта XMMS - Beep.

а зачем они вообще погналичь за винампом ? winamp не самый лучший плейр? лучше бы сделали нормальное кол-во эквалайзеров, а то блин ещё один винамп галимый.

anonymous ()
[#]  

Re: Fork проекта XMMS - Beep.

а вот под виндой есть такая вещичка - foobar2000. и за его невзрачным интерфесом скрывается великолепный, фичастый плейер. никто подобного под linux-ом не видел?

anonymous ()
[#] Ответ на: Re: Re: Fork проекта XMMS - Beep. от anonymous 23.10.2003 17:48:01  

Re: Re: Re: Fork проекта XMMS - Beep.

А alsaplayer поддерживает плейлисты? Насколько я помню, нет. Вообще, я пользуюсь cplay (консольный фронт-энд к различным плейерам), но он бедновать в визуальном плане (не показывает тэги и т.п.). А под нормальным гуевым плейером я имел в виду что-то типа foobar2000 под win32.

anonymous ()
[#] Ответ на: Re: Учите русский язык! от svyatogor 23.10.2003 19:05:24  
jackill

Re: Re: Учите русский язык!

Тогда ещу научись говорить по-русски.
настраИВАемого...
А плеер - да, уже давно в обиходе.

***** ()
[#] Ответ на: Re: Re: Re: Fork проекта XMMS - Beep. от anonymous 23.10.2003 21:38:14  
jackill

Re: Re: Re: Re: Fork проекта XMMS - Beep.

Чем интерфейс винампа не устраивает? Лично я xmms пускаю и сворачиваю. Я его потом не вижу часами.

P.S. А рулить вообще предпочитаю с пульта.

***** ()
[#] Ответ на: Re: Re: Учите русский язык! от anonymous 23.10.2003 19:36:28  

Re: Re: Re: Учите русский язык!

Ну давайте теперь на это форуме флеймить по поводу знания русского языка. Ещё может начнём дружно проверять наличие запятых в предложениях и прочее .. Можно подумать, кто-то из присутствующих не пронял что player=плейер .. Или есть такое, кто не знает значения слова 'плейер' ?

anonymous ()
[#] Ответ на: Re: Re: Re: Учите русский язык! от anonymous 23.10.2003 21:45:18  

Re: Re: Re: Re: Уччите руский езык!

я иго учу вавсю и уже пачти вес выучел!!

anonymous ()
[#]  

Re: Fork проекта XMMS - Beep.

У xmms'а неудобный плэйлист, слишком простой.
Мне, лично, нужен нормальный поиск и классификация.
Нативно.

anonymous ()
[#] Ответ на: Re: Re: Re: Fork проекта XMMS - Beep. от anonymous 23.10.2003 21:38:14  

Re: Re: Re: Re: Fork проекта XMMS - Beep.

>А alsaplayer поддерживает плейлисты? Насколько я помню, нет

Плохо у вас с памятью ;)

***** ()
[#]  
sun

Fork проекта XMMS - Beep.

Вот было бы действительно хорошо если бы на mplayer натянули бы такой интерфейс чтобы было удобно им пользоваться, тогда xmms на второй план отойдёт, тем более что mplayer может использовать плагины xmms. Ну и совсем для успокоения души ещё что-то типо mp3blaster в добавок привинтить на mplayer. Может ещё чего на фатназировать...

* ()
[#] Ответ на: Re: Re: Учите русский язык! от anonymous 23.10.2003 19:36:28  
svyatogor

Re: Re: Re: Учите русский язык!

>I would rather not be that assured if i were you and i'm pretty sure >you have not passed an ordinary level ;)

O Level grade B :D

>В русском языке есть слово, которое абсолютно адекватно отражает смысл >"player". Тот факт, что у кого-то проблемы с базовой лексикой, не >добавляет в русский язык мусор вроде "плейер", "роутер", "вау".

Согласен, но новость писалась в расчете на основных посетителей сего сайта, привычных к 'кульный хацкер' и 'фейсом об тейбл' ;)

Черт, а 'настриваемым' я и правда ляпу дал :(

***** ()
[#] Ответ на: Re: Re: Учите русский язык! от anonymous 23.10.2003 19:36:28  
svyatogor

Re: Re: Re: Учите русский язык!

>I would rather not be that assured if i were you and i'm pretty sure >you have not passed an ordinary level ;)

O Level grade B :D

>В русском языке есть слово, которое абсолютно адекватно отражает смысл >"player". Тот факт, что у кого-то проблемы с базовой лексикой, не >добавляет в русский язык мусор вроде "плейер", "роутер", "вау".

Согласен, но новость писалась в расчете на основных посетителей сего сайта, привычных к 'кульный хацкер' и 'фейсом об тейбл' ;)

Черт, а 'настриваемым' я и правда ляпу дал :(

***** ()
[#] Ответ на: про перекодировку tag'-ов в ogg... от Dselect 23.10.2003 19:25:38  
pitekantrop

Re: про перекодировку tag'-ов в ogg...

> Восьмибитные кодировки -- на помойку!

Ты что??? А как же самая правильная кодировка UTF-8????

*** ()
[#] Ответ на: Re: про перекодировку tag'-ов в ogg... от pitekantrop 24.10.2003 0:13:13  
Dselect

про UTF-8

2 pitekantrop:

> А как же самая правильная кодировка UTF-8?

$ man -k utf8

utf8 (7) - an ASCII compatible multi-byte Unicode encoding

[snipped]

*** ()
[#] Ответ на: Re: Fork проекта XMMS - Beep. от anonymous 23.10.2003 22:37:42  

Re: Re: Fork проекта XMMS - Beep.

>Мне, лично, нужен нормальный поиск и классификация.
Хороший поиск и классификация есть только у майкрософтового WMP9 - называется media library. Юниксам ещё до этого расти и расти, только и можете винамп слямзить :-)

anonymous ()
[#] Ответ на: Re: Re: Re: Fork проекта XMMS - Beep. от anonymous 23.10.2003 17:33:01  

Re: Re: Re: Re: Fork проекта XMMS - Beep.

>Нормальный интерфейс - это интерфейс, отличный от размалеванного винамповского квадратика. Вообще не понимаю, зачем было тянуть эту гадость в линукс.

А это стандарт, наверное ;). У меня плееер с таким же интерфейсом под BeOS был. С другой стороны, винамп и винамп,- какая разница?

anonymous ()
[#] Ответ на: Re: Re: Re: Re: Fork проекта XMMS - Beep. от anonymous 24.10.2003 1:10:23  

Re: Re: Re: Re: Re: Fork проекта XMMS - Beep.

Во народ %). Опять обосрали все что только можно было.

anonymous ()
[#]  
azazello

Fork проекта XMMS - Beep.

в орининале это порт XMMS на GTK2, но люди из команды XMMS вежливо попросили автора исключить из названия XMMS - вот он Beep'ом и стал...

а насчёт квадратности WinAmp 1) для совместимости скинов.. 2) интерфейс по умолчанию у WinAmp 5 очень даже приятен..

** ()
[#] Ответ на: Re: про перекодировку tag'-ов в ogg... от pitekantrop 24.10.2003 0:13:13  
Irsi

Re: Re: про перекодировку tag'-ов в ogg...

2pitekantrop: чего, ферментированого мамонтого молока перепил?! Это с какого бодуна UTF-8 стала восьмибитной?

# ()
[#] Ответ на: Re: Re: Fork проекта XMMS - Beep. от anonymous 24.10.2003 0:50:45  
Irsi

Re: Re: Re: Fork проекта XMMS - Beep.

>> Мне, лично, нужен нормальный поиск и классификация.
> Хороший поиск и классификация есть только у майкрософтового WMP9 - называется media library.

Угу, а у Apple в iTunes, эта же фича как обычно сделано удобней...:)

# ()
[#] Ответ на: Re: Re: Re: Fork проекта XMMS - Beep. от Irsi 24.10.2003 10:18:42  

Re: Re: Re: Re: Fork проекта XMMS - Beep.

хоть кто-нить собрать пытался? :) как обошли вилы с Xxf86vm?

** ()
[#] Ответ на: Re: Re: Re: Fork проекта XMMS - Beep. от Irsi 24.10.2003 10:18:42  

Re: Re: Re: Re: Fork проекта XMMS - Beep.

>> Хороший поиск и классификация есть только у майкрософтового WMP9 - называется media library.

>Угу, а у Apple в iTunes, эта же фича как обычно сделано удобней...:)
Не знаю как в iTunes, но в Winamp'е media library, появившаяся в
версиях 2.9х (AFAIR), поудобнее, чем в WMP9 (IMHO)...
Интерфейс у Winamp и XMMS удобный и привычный потому как не
перегружен лишними деталями, элементов управления вполне достаточно,
они маленькие но вполне функциональные (IMHO)

***## ()
[#] Ответ на: Re: Re: Учите русский язык! от Led 23.10.2003 19:04:07  

насчёт *player'ов...

>А вобще неплохо было бы иметь эдакий soundd с плагинами, который бы загружался при старте как сервис и управлялся бы по HTTP (как это делает CUPS), тогда и интерфейс к нему можно было бы прикрутить любой в два счёта: хоть CLI, хоть GUI, хоть Web...

есть примерно такая масяня ;). mpd называется, к ней gtk2-морда, кстати... вполне рабочая.

вообще проект антиресный, gtk1 в xmms'е поднадоел у свете xfce4 ;)

вообще-то alsaplayer очень неплох по основе, НО: gtk1-морда с русскими тэгами --- крякозябрами, полный ноль еффект-плагинов :(, эквалайзера в частности. для xmms'а есть eqXmms, всеядный эквалайзер с числом полос до 31.

* ()
[#]  

Re: Fork проекта XMMS - Beep.

Apollo бы лучше портировали.. Более удобного интерфейса еще не встречал. Тот порт что есть делали руки из жопы.

anonymous ()
[#] Ответ на: Re: Fork проекта XMMS - Beep. от anonymous 24.10.2003 11:13:23  

Re: Fork проекта XMMS - Beep.

Даже в винде пробовали. Глюкалово страшное. Особливо по части интерфейса.
Хорошо, что под винду mpg123 есть, а то бы не выжил ;-)
Теперь совсем (с music123) и под Linux`ом прекрасно.

А вам бы все GTK/Qt какие прикручивать, вместо того, чтобы подумать головной мозгой - что именно нужно от плеера, да либо заставить авторов наиболее перспективного из оных реализовать ваши вишесы, либо нарисовать оные самостоятельно в, например, Tcl/Tk, или еще чём...

* ()
[#] Ответ на: Re: Re: Re: Re: Fork проекта XMMS - Beep. от grustnoe 24.10.2003 10:34:54  

Re: Re: Re: Re: Re: Fork проекта XMMS - Beep.

Добавь в Makefile, что лежит в beep, в месте где используется Xxf86vm путь к этой либе
-L/usr/X11R6/lib
не помню, в каком месте. Поищи, там не много мест :)

* ()